About this Scholarship

Azim Premji University is committed to developing leaders in the fields of Education and Development, who are passionate about building a more just, equitable and humane society.

Our students experience a vibrant, multi-disciplinary learning environment with:

  • An enriching blend of theory and practice that informs the curriculum, learning processes, field work and institutional design at all levels.
  • A faculty group of leading academicians and practitioners who integrate academic rigour with real world experience.
  • A supportive yet challenging culture of enquiry and discovery.

Applications are invited from working professionals, teachers and fresh graduates for admission to the Masters Programmes.

The Post Graduate Programmes offered are:

  • Master of Arts in Education: Develops outstanding professionals for fulfilling careers in Education, including as administrators, curriculum designers, entrepreneurs, technology experts, policy specialists, researchers etc.
  • Master of Arts in Development: Builds high calibre professionals for leadership in the social sector, with abilities in inter-related development domains, ranging from Governance & Health to Ecology.
  • Master’s in Teacher Education: Develops highly competent teacher educators.

Eligibility Criteria

Eligibility criteria for the Masters Programmes include:

  • A Bachelor’s degree in any discipline with a minimum of 50% marks.
  • A valid score in the entrance examination.
  • Work experience in the relevant field is preferred but not mandatory.
